3. Working Principle of Planetary Gearboxes

Planetary gearboxes are composed of a central sun gear, planet gears, and an outer ring gear. The sun gear is driven by the input shaft, and the planet gears engage both the sun gear and the ring gear. The rotation of the planet gears around the sun gear creates the desired gear ratio and transmits motion to the output shaft.

4. Choosing the Right Planetary Gearboxes for Paper Production

When selecting planetary gearboxes for paper production equipment, several factors should be considered:

4.1 Torque Requirements

Calculate the maximum torque demand of the paper production equipment and choose a planetary gearbox with a torque rating that exceeds the calculated value.

4.2 Speed Range

Determine the required speed range for the equipment and select a gearbox that can accommodate the desired speed variations while maintaining stable operation.

4.3 Gear Ratio

Choose a planetary gearbox with a suitable gear ratio to achieve the desired output speed and torque for the specific application in paper production.

4.4 Mounting Configuration

Consider the mounting requirements of the paper production equipment and select a planetary gearbox with a suitable mounting configuration, such as flange or foot mounting.

4.5 Lubrication and Sealing

Ensure that the selected planetary gearbox has appropriate lubrication and sealing mechanisms to withstand the demanding operating conditions in the paper production industry.

5. Installation of Planetary Gearboxes

The installation process of planetary gearboxes in paper production equipment involves the following steps:

5.1 Preparation

Clean the mounting surface of the equipment and ensure that it is free from any debris or contaminants that could affect the alignment and performance of the gearbox.

5.2 Alignment

Align the input and output shafts of the gearbox with the corresponding shafts in the paper production equipment, ensuring proper alignment to minimize misalignment-induced wear and noise.

5.3 Mounting

Securely mount the planetary gearbox onto the equipment using the appropriate fasteners, following the manufacturer’s instructions and recommended torque values.

5.4 Lubrication

Properly lubricate the gearbox according to the manufacturer’s specifications, using the recommended lubricant type and quantity to ensure optimal performance and longevity.
